Output 3f8fecccedf6b6c3701b1f25ee0f1170974731a119d76ae1f28c66194ef7de59:1

value
178040632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e800c1e2d81c84b095e53d6c005a304ab92fb553 OP_EQUAL
address
ADazLWxBt7M3bXENxqd4yNzrAjbwSEDvB3
transaction
3f8fecccedf6b6c3701b1f25ee0f1170974731a119d76ae1f28c66194ef7de59